One of the key benefits of mass production in the development of compact mixing machines is cost savings. By producing large quantities of the same machine, manufacturers can reduce costs associated with raw materials, labor, and overhead expenses. This allows them to pass those savings on to customers, resulting in lower prices for consumers.
Another benefit of mass production is increased efficiency. With larger batch sizes, manufacturers can optimize their production processes and reduce waste. This not only saves money but also reduces environmental impact by reducing the amount of raw materials and energy used in the manufacturing process.
Finally, mass production enables manufacturers to quickly respond to changing market demands. As new technologies and materials become available, manufacturers can quickly adapt their production processes to incorporate these improvements into their products. This ensures that they remain competitive in the market and meet the evolving needs of their customers.
